Find the most complete information of according vehicle towing in St. John's, Newfoundland and Labrador, phones, addresses, schedules, comments, maps and much more in St. John's, Newfoundland and Labrador, Truthful comments about companies in Canada. according vehicle towing near you, consult here the different businesses, home delivery in St. John's, tell all your friends about Nexdu, say that you saw it in Nexdu Business Directory.